Accuracy refers to how close the dmm measurement is to the actual value of the signal being measured. Accuracy and resolution are the key specifications to consider when choosing the right digital multimeter (dmm) for your measurements. Accuracy is expressed as a percentage and indicates how close the displayed measurement is to the actual (standard) value of the signal measured.
